bottle, pours a deep golden color, with a thin white head. A nutty, strong malt aroma. Tons of malt with a fruity/sweet ending that lingers for a minute. There is almost an almond note after swallowing. Low carbonation, mellow mouth. An interesting ale, brewed by Czech monks. And interesting in the fact that it is an ale, from a lager dominate country. Easy to drink, and fairly enjoyable, but it’s aroma is lacking and light.
